ICT service exports in Belarus
Belarus: ICT service exports was 3.24 billion BoP, current US$ in 2021. ◆ Volatile
ICT service exports in Belarus, 1993–2021
Source: Balance of Payments Statistics Yearbook and data files, International Monetary Fund (IMF). Measured in BoP, current US$.
Analysis
The most recent figure for ict service exports in Belarus is 3.24 billion BoP, current US$, measured in 2021. That is the highest value across all 29 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 19.9% on the previous year and up 607.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, ict service exports in Belarus peaked at 3.24 billion BoP, current US$ in 2021 and was at its lowest, 2.40 million BoP, current US$, in 1993.
That places Belarus 44th out of 187 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Information and communication technology service exports include computer and communications services (telecommunications and postal and courier services) and information services (computer data and news-related service transactions). Data are in current U.S. dollars.
